To obtain a rich yield organically, commence with healthy soil. Consider adding compost and well-rotted manure to enhance its composition. Select disease-resistant plant types adapted to your area climate. Water deeply but fewer frequently, fostering deep root growth. Finally, attract helpful insects by planting polyculture like herbs and aromatics to naturally repel pests.

Professional Advice: Fresh Organic Gardening Suggestions You Can Employ Today
Want a bountiful organic garden? Our team of seasoned horticulturists shares simple, practical advice you can start immediately! Don't fret about intricate techniques; we're focusing on easy solutions for novices and established gardeners as well. Here are a few essential takeaways to improve your garden's health :
- Enrich your soil ! Adding your own compost increases nutrients and permeability.
- Water deeply but less often. This encourages healthier root expansion.
- Vary your produce annually to avoid ground-based problems.
- Encourage friendly creatures with neighboring plants .
- Protect your beds with natural substances to keep moisture and prevent unwanted plants .
By following these essential guidelines, you'll be well on your way to a stunning and tasty organic harvest ! Remember to notice your garden closely and change your approaches as required .
